HYPERKERATOSIS IN RESPONSE TO MECHANICAL IRRITATION
[摘要] Five human subjects who rubbed their skin with a tongue blade, using aquaphor as a lubricant, for 10 min. daily for 30 days, showed an avg. of 38% increase in thickness of the horny layer in the rubbed site as measured planimetrically on magnified biopsy sections. Non-cornified epidermis showed no significant change. Rubbing without lubricant and application of lubricant without rubbing caused no significant change in thickness of cornified and non-cornified epidermis. It is concluded that the hyperkeratosis is due to increased cohesiveness of the horny lamellae and a decreased rate of physiological shedding.
